Ticket: NIGHT ACCESS — Support team, Quillbrook Tower. Requesting after-hours entry for six support staff, effective this Thursday, covering 22:00–06:00 shifts through end of month. Main lobby locks at 21:00; staff will use the east service entrance. Motion lighting on level two needs checking — flagged twice last week. Please confirm cleaner schedule doesn't conflict. Bin collection stays as-is. Night staff should carry ID at all times and enter via the keypad using the access code below.

badge for fafop-fajof: bdg-Z-47

Hey — welcome aboard! Quick context before I roll off. The Quillfeather catalog API flakes out most Tuesdays during their batch window, so we wrapped all calls in a circuit breaker (see breaker.go in the fetcher service). It trips after 5 consecutive failures, half-opens after 30s. Don't bump those numbers without pinging Marisol first — we tuned them after the March incident. Dashboards show trip counts per endpoint. Full config docs and the tuning rationale live on the internal wiki page here:

wiki page, yajep-fajog: https://confluence.torvahq.local/ticket/display/dash/settings/merge_requests/ticket/run/a3215cc5a3d8263468d4c885

Q: What can the Semaphor deploy-status bot actually access? A: Read-only. It queries the Ledgerline API for deploy state and surfaces it in chat; it cannot trigger, pause, or roll back deploys. Responses are scoped to the requester's team. Audit logs retain all queries for 90 days. Token scoping, threat model notes, and the permission matrix are on the internal page below.

wiki page, tahaf-tajog: https://jira.ordindyn.corp/pipeline

### Runbook: Payment Retry Idempotency

Quick refresher for the sync: every retry through Tillgate's payment worker carries an idempotency key derived from the order hash plus attempt window. Duplicate keys short-circuit before we ever hit the processor, so double charges shouldn't happen — if they do, the key table is where to look. Keys expire after 72 hours via a TTL sweep. When debugging a suspected dupe, query the idempotency ledger directly; connect to it with the string below.

primary connection of tajeg-tajop = postgresql://julax_svc:DI@db-e7f3.kelvidyn.corp:5432/rusdor